Smart Climate Sensors
Smart weather sensing units have transformed the efficiency of contemporary watering systems by changing sprinkling timetables based on real-time environmental data. These sensors monitor variables such as temperature, humidity, wind speed, and solar radiation, enabling systems to react dynamically to transforming weather problems. By incorporating this information, wise sensing units can enhance water use, decreasing waste and making sure that landscapes get the proper amount of moisture. This innovation not only saves water but also advertises much healthier plant development by preventing overwatering or underwatering. Additionally, the automation given by clever climate sensors enhances user ease, as landscapers and house owners can rely upon specific watering timetables without manual treatment. Soil Wetness Sensors
Dirt moisture sensing units play a vital function in modern-day irrigation systems, offering real-time information that improves water effectiveness. These tools measure the volumetric water content in the dirt, enabling exact assessments of dampness levels. By incorporating soil wetness sensing units into irrigation systems, customers can prevent overwatering or underwatering, inevitably promoting healthier plant growth and conserving water resources.The sensing units transfer information to controllers, which can change sprinkling schedules based upon current soil problems. This data-driven approach minimizes water waste and assurances that plants receive the ideal quantity of moisture.
